2-69. DIAPHRAGM PUMPS (CHEMICAL FEED PUMP) MAINTENANCE - continued.
REPAIR
a. Disassembly.
(1) Unscrew adapter (39) from valve body (35).
(2) Remove o-ring (38), ball stop (36), and valve ball (37) from adapter (39).
(3) Unscrew valve body (35) from reagent head (3).
(4) Remove o-ring (34), ball stop (32) and valve ball (33) from valve body (35).
(5) Unscrew adapter (22) from valve body (26) and remove o-ring (23).
(6) Unscrew valve body (26) from valve body (30).
(7) Remove o-ring (27), ball stop (24), and valve ball (25) from valve body (26).
(8) Unscrew valve body (30) from reagent head (3).
(9) Remove o-ring (31), ball stop (28), and valve ball (29) from valve body (30).
b. Cleaning.
(1) Wash all components with clean water and detergent.
(2) Rinse components in clean water and dry with wiping rag.
(3) Clean valve body (26, 30, and 35) passages. Remove all dirt, particles, and contaminates. Pay close attention
to valve ball seats. Even small particles of dirt in this area can effect operation of diaphragm pump.
c. Inspection.
(1) Inspect all threaded components for damaged threads
(2) Inspect valve bodies (26, 30, and 35) for clogged passages.
(3) Inspect working diaphragm (8) and guard diaphragm (13) for holes, cracks, and deterioration.
(4) Inspect backing plate (9) for corrosion.
(5) Inspect valve balls (25, 29, 33, and 37) for flat spots and irregular surface.
